The dynamic scale loop is a tube blocking system for the evaluation of scale
inhibitors. The basic principal involves mixing two incompatible brines in a narrow
bore test coil. Scale begins to form in the coil creating a differential pressure. The
time taken for this formation gives an indication of inhibitor performance.

The control software enables the user to view all data in an easy to understand
manner. The graphs display historical pressure and temperature information,
whereas the schematic shows all current data in addition to the pumps status.

The above graph show typical results. The untreated brine forms scale and starts to
block the test coil after about 12 minutes (Blank). The test is then repeated with
scale inhibitor present, firstly at 3ppm, automatically reducing to 2ppm after 45
minutes and finally reducing to 1ppm after 90 minutes. At about 110 minutes the test
coil starts to block again indicating insufficient inhibitor. At this point the unit
automatically cleans itself.
